Enjoy a spectacular dish following the recipe prepared by @nahuelpomponio on today's show! 👉 PICKLED VEGETABLE TONGUE VINAIGRETTE 🔥. . 🔥Ingredients: For the tongue: 4 pieces of pork tongue 3 L of water 150 g of salt 1 bay leaf Oregano Herbs Garlic For the vinaigrette: 200 ml of Cabernet Sauerkraut 20 g of brown sugar 100 ml of olive oil 2 tbsp of vinegar 1 tbsp of chopped herbs For the vegetables: 1/2 piece of red, green, and yellow bell pepper 1 piece of fennel 1 red onion 1/2 cucumbers 1L red wine vinegar Honey To finish: 2 tbsp capers 2 anchovies Salad: Candied mushrooms in jars: 3 oyster mushrooms 3 portobello mushrooms 1 clove garlic Olive oil (to taste) Thyme and rosemary 150g blanched potato halves 5 blanched asparagus halves Olive oil Salt and pepper . Process: 1. Prepare a brine with water, salt, bay leaves, garlic, and herbs. Boil the tongues and cook for 1 hour after they come to a boil. Let them cool in the liquid and then peel them. 2. Meanwhile, bring the vinegar and honey to a boil and submerge the vegetables in the hot liquid. Let it cool. 3. For the vinaigrette, reduce the wine with the brown sugar. Cool and emulsify with the olive oil and vinegar. Season with salt and pepper and herbs. 4. For the mushrooms: Place the chopped mushrooms in a sterilized jar, add 1 peeled garlic clove, rosemary, thyme, and peppercorns. Cover with olive oil and seal. Place in a saucepan with water and cook at 80°C for 1 1/4 hours. Cool and mix with the blanched baby potatoes and asparagus. 5.
